PikeOS Software Overview

What is PikeOS?

PikeOS is a real-time operating system (RTOS) developed by SYSGO, known for its innovative separation kernel architecture. This architecture enables the concurrent execution of multiple operating system instances on a single hardware platform, ensuring isolation between them for increased reliability and security.

It is widely used in safety-critical and embedded systems, particularly in industries such as aerospace, automotive, and industrial automation. It offers strong safety and security features, including certification up to SIL 4 and ASIL D, making it suitable for applications with stringent requirements. Additionally, PikeOS provides a comprehensive development environment and support for various hardware platforms, facilitating efficient software development and deployment.
